Course Content

• Introduction to Mechatronics Systems
• Mechanical Systems Design & Analysis (CAD, kinematics, dynamics)
• Electrical and Electronic Circuits for Mechatronics
• Programmable Logic Controllers (PLCs) and Industrial Automation
• Sensors and Actuators in Mechatronics
• Microcontroller Programming and Applications (Embedded Systems)
• Control Systems Engineering (PID control, feedback systems)
• Robotics and Automation Systems (Industrial Robots, Robotic Arms)
• Mechatronics Project and Integration

Career path

Mechatronics Career Roles (UK) Description
Robotics Engineer (Mechatronics, Robotics, Automation) Design, build, and maintain robotic systems; crucial in automation and manufacturing.
Control Systems Engineer (Control Systems, Mechatronics, Automation) Develop and implement control systems for automated machinery; high demand in industrial settings.
Automation Engineer (Mechatronics, Automation, Robotics) Integrate automated systems in various industries; essential for streamlining processes.
Maintenance Technician (Mechatronics, Maintenance, Repair) Maintain and repair mechatronic equipment; vital for minimizing downtime.
Research and Development Engineer (Mechatronics, R&D, Innovation) Develop new mechatronic technologies and improve existing ones; drives future innovation.
